域名怎么解析到服务器中,深度解析,域名解析至服务器的全过程与优化技巧
- 综合资讯
- 2024-11-09 17:41:04
- 0
域名解析至服务器全过程包括域名注册、DNS服务器配置、设置DNS记录、添加A记录或CNAME记录等步骤。优化技巧包括选择合适的DNS服务商、使用CDN、优化DNS记录、...
域名解析至服务器全过程包括域名注册、DNS服务器配置、设置DNS记录、添加A记录或CNAME记录等步骤。优化技巧包括选择合适的DNS服务商、使用CDN、优化DNS记录、缓存策略等,以确保解析速度和稳定性。
随着互联网的飞速发展,域名已经成为人们生活中不可或缺的一部分,一个简洁、易记的域名能够帮助企业或个人在网络上树立良好的品牌形象,域名的解析过程相对复杂,涉及到多个环节,本文将详细介绍域名解析至服务器的全过程,并分享一些优化技巧,帮助您更好地理解和应用域名解析。
域名解析的基本原理
1、域名解析的概念
域名解析是指将人类易于记忆的域名转换为计算机易于处理的IP地址的过程,就是将用户输入的域名转换为对应服务器的IP地址,以便服务器能够正确地响应请求。
2、域名解析的流程
(1)客户端发起请求:用户在浏览器中输入域名,并按下回车键。
(2)本地DNS缓存查询:操作系统会检查本地DNS缓存中是否存储有该域名的IP地址,如果存在,则直接返回IP地址,无需继续查询。
(3)递归查询:如果本地DNS缓存中没有该域名的IP地址,则向本地DNS服务器发起递归查询请求。
(4)根域名服务器查询:本地DNS服务器向根域名服务器发起查询请求,获取顶级域名服务器的IP地址。
(5)顶级域名服务器查询:本地DNS服务器向顶级域名服务器发起查询请求,获取二级域名的解析信息。
(6)权威域名服务器查询:本地DNS服务器向权威域名服务器发起查询请求,获取目标域名的解析信息。
(7)响应查询结果:权威域名服务器将目标域名的IP地址返回给本地DNS服务器,本地DNS服务器再将IP地址返回给客户端。
(8)客户端获取IP地址:客户端获取到目标域名的IP地址后,与服务器建立连接,完成请求。
域名解析优化技巧
1、使用CDN技术
CDN(内容分发网络)可以将网站内容分发到全球各地的服务器上,当用户访问网站时,可以自动选择距离最近的节点进行访问,从而提高访问速度,CDN还可以分担服务器压力,提高网站稳定性。
2、设置合理的DNS记录
(1)A记录:将域名解析到服务器IP地址。
(2)CNAME记录:将域名解析到另一个域名,如CDN提供商的域名。
(3)MX记录:用于邮箱解析,将邮件发送到指定的邮件服务器。
(4)TXT记录:用于验证域名所有权,提高邮箱安全性。
3、设置DNS缓存时间
DNS缓存时间(TTL)是指本地DNS服务器缓存解析结果的时长,合理的DNS缓存时间可以提高解析速度,降低查询次数,但过长的缓存时间可能导致解析结果更新不及时,建议根据实际情况设置合适的DNS缓存时间。
4、使用DNS解析集群
DNS解析集群可以提高解析速度和稳定性,降低单点故障风险,通过将域名解析请求分发到多个DNS服务器,可以均衡负载,提高解析效率。
5、监控DNS解析性能
定期监控DNS解析性能,及时发现并解决潜在问题,如解析速度慢、解析失败等。
本文链接:https://www.zhitaoyun.cn/712731.html
发表评论